扫二维码与项目经理沟通
我们在微信上24小时期待你的声音
解答本文疑问/技术咨询/运营咨询/技术建议/互联网交流
1、默认模式,提供主库的最高可用性能
创新互联是少有的网站设计、成都网站设计、营销型企业网站、小程序设计、手机APP,开发、制作、设计、卖友情链接、推广优化一站式服务网络公司,成立于2013年,坚持透明化,价格低,无套路经营理念。让网页惊喜每一位访客多年来深受用户好评
2、保证主库在运行之中不会受到从库的干扰
优点:避免从库对主库的影响
缺点:不能保证数据不丢失(通过归档的方式,一直查一个arch,如果主库彻底没了,那么redo中的数据会丢失),最低的情况,丢失一个redo组
步骤如下
1.前期规划
2.配置网络监听
3.修改参数文件
4.rman duplicate 复制数据库
5.启动调试数据库
6.测试
首先需要确定dg的保护模式是什么?
如果是最大保护模式,那么在备库停机时,主库也会挂起等待备库响应,造成不必要的麻烦;
如果是最大性能或最大高可用模式,备库可以直接shutdown;
首先启动windows命令。在开始菜单中输入cmd命令
输入启动命令:"net start oracleservieYAOYY" [Yaoyy代表实例名称,不区分大小写]
使用sqlplus方式登录数据库,测试启动是否正常。
登录成功后,会有以下页面,并且命令前缀变成:“SQL ”方式
使用简单的查询语句可以看到系统正常执行sql语句.
操作完之后,退出系统使用命令:"exit;"进行退出
停止oracle服务. 使用命令:"net stop oracleserviceyaoyy"注意后面没有分号.
oracle DG 启动和关闭顺序
启动顺序:先启动备库,后启动主库
关闭顺序:先关闭主库,后关闭备库
1、正确打开备库和主库
备库:
SQL STARTUPMOUNT;
SQLALTERDATABASE RECOVER MANAGED STANDBY DATABASE DISCONNECT FROM SESSION;
主库:
SQL STARTUPMOUNT;
SQL ALTERDATABASE ARCHIVELOG;
SQL ALTER DATABASEOPEN;
2、正确关闭顺序
主库
SQLSHUTDOWN IMMEDIATE;
备库:
SQL ALTER DATABASE RECOVER MANAGED STANDBYDATABASE CANCEL;
SQLSHUTDOWN IMMEDIATE;
1、打开命令行窗口界面,可以同时按住“ctrl+R”键,在弹出来的运行窗口中输入cmd。2、启动oracle服务,在命令行窗口中输入“netstartoracleserviceXXXX”后面的XXXX实际是需要根据您自己的数据库实例名进行替换。如果您不知道,可以看下“计算机管理”界面下的服务中,能不能找到服务名类似的服务。提示“服务已经启动成功”就说明服务启动起来了。3、启动监听程序,在命令行窗口输入lsnrctlstart,等到提示“命令执行成功”就可以了。4、接下来就开始加载数据库实例了。在命令行窗口输入“sqlplus/assysdba”登录到一个空闲的例程。5、登录完成后,输入“startup”。这个过程可能有点慢,直到出现“数据库已经打开”则表示实例启动成功了。6、测试一下把,随便连接一个数据库用户,如果提示“连接成功”则说明数据库服务现在可以正常使用了。注意事项如果操作过程中提示“监听已经启动”,“服务已经运行”等,则可以跳过相应步骤,继续执行。
我们在微信上24小时期待你的声音
解答本文疑问/技术咨询/运营咨询/技术建议/互联网交流